Enemies, a Love Story (1989)

Ron Silver is a Holocaust survivor, immigrated to post-war New York and trying to balance the three women in his life. These women (his thought to have died in the war first wife, his second wife who saved his life during the war, and his girlfriend who is also a survivor) epitomize the three distinct periods in his life and his unsuccessful attempts to reconcile them into his current self. I’m not sure how I felt about the movie itself, it’s a bit repetitious and unsure of where it wants go. I do know that the performance I thought was the strongest was the one female that was not Oscar nominated, Margaret Sophie Stein as Silver’s dedicated former maid/current wife.

Oscar Nominations: Best Actress in a Supporting Role (2); Best Writing, Screenplay Based on Material from Another Medium
